Getting Ashore

Most cruise ships berth alongside on Usedom Island, a short walk from the spa district; large ships on Wolin use the free Bielik ferry.

Getting Ashore in Świnoujście

  • 1
    Usedom Quay (most ships)Ships dock at Władysław IV Quay on Usedom Island. City centre is 500 m away — a 5–10 minute walk along the riverfront.
  • 2
    Wolin / Ferry Terminal (large ships)If you dock on the Wolin side, walk to the free Bielik pedestrian ferry, which runs every 20 minutes and crosses in about 10 minutes to Usedom. Taxis can now use the 2023 road tunnel too.
  • 3
    To the beachFrom city centre, walk 20–25 minutes (1.8 km) through Park Zdrojowy (Spa Park) to the promenade and beach, or take a 5-minute taxi/tuk-tuk.

💡 Pro move: The free pedestrian ferry (Bielik) runs daily when ships are in port. Taxis accept card payment — Poland is nearly cashless.

Top Excursions

From Prussian fortresses to a Baltic beach, Świnoujście rewards explorers — and independent travellers can skip tours entirely.

Iconic

Stawa Młyny & West Breakwater Walk

Stroll 1.5 km along the West Mole to the windmill-shaped navigation beacon at its tip — Świnoujście's iconic symbol. Flat, scenic, and free.

⏱ 1–1.5 hrs🚶 Easy📷 Iconic💰 Free

History

Fort Gerhard & the Lighthouse

On Wolin Island, Fort Gerhard is one of Europe's best-preserved 19th-century Prussian coastal forts with costumed guides. Next door, climb 308 steps to the top of the world's tallest brick lighthouse for panoramic Baltic views.

⏱ 2–3 hrs🚶 Moderate (308 steps)🏰 History💰 ~30 PLN total

Adventure

Cycle to Germany

Rent a bike at the port and pedal 6 km along a paved coastal cycle path into Germany — past the border arch to the imperial spa resorts of Ahlbeck and Heringsdorf. No passport control; just a steel arch marks the line.

⏱ 3–4 hrs🚴 Easy (flat)🌍 Cross-border💰 Bike hire ~30 PLN

Relax

Baltic Beach & Promenade

Świnoujście's Blue Flag beach is up to 200 m wide with powdery white sand — among the finest on the Baltic. Walk through the 19th-century Spa Park to reach the promenade, rent a Strandkorb wicker chair, and relax.

⏱ 2-4 hrs🏖 Leisurely☀️ Blue Flag beach💰 Free (chair hire extra)

Culture

Fort Anioła & Old Town

Fort Anioła (Fort Angel) on Usedom is modelled on Rome's Castel Sant'Angelo, now housing an art gallery, a café in the brick vaults, and a historic weapons exhibit. Pair it with a wander through Plac Wolności and the spa-town architecture.

⏱ 1.5–2 hrs🚶 Easy🎨 Art & history💰 ~15 PLN

Self-Guided Walks & Hikes

Świnoujście's Usedom side is flat and very walkable — beach, spa park, city centre, forts, and the German border all connect on foot or by bike.

City Centre to Beach via Spa Park

2 km · 25 min · Easy · Free

From the quay, walk through Plac Wolności (city square), enter the historic Park Zdrojowy designed by Peter Lenné, follow the main allee through canals and mature trees, and emerge onto the promenade and beach.

Breakwater Walk to Stawa Młyny

3 km round-trip · 40 min · Easy · Free

Head northwest from the port along the West Mole (Zachodnie Nabrzeże) to the tip, where the famous Stawa Młyny windmill beacon stands. Great views of ships entering the Świna River and the open Baltic.

Insider Tips

  • 💳
    Go cashless: Poland is nearly 100% card-based — Visa, Mastercard, Apple Pay and Google Pay work everywhere, including taxis, ferries, and market stalls. No need to exchange currency.
  • 🇩🇪
    Walk into Germany: The Polish-German border is unmarked — no passport control. The coastal path to Ahlbeck (Germany) is flat, paved, and a highlight for most visitors. Budget 2-3 hours for a return walk or 1-1.5 hours by bike.
  • ⛴️
    Free Bielik ferry: If your ship docks on the Wolin side, the pedestrian ferry to Usedom (Usedomer side) is free, runs every 20 minutes, and takes about 10 minutes — don't pay taxi prices to use the tunnel for a short hop.
  • 🐟
    Eat smoked fish: Look for a local wędzarnia (smokehouse) near the market or port — smoked Baltic cod, mackerel, or halibut wrapped in paper is the authentic local snack, usually under 20 PLN.
  • 🏰
    Fort Gerhard books up: Guided tours of Fort Gerhard (the Prussian fort on Wolin) have limited slots. Book online in advance or arrive early — the guides in Prussian uniforms make it worth the effort.

Getting Around

Transport options from the pier — taxis, shuttles, transit passes, and whether ride-share apps work here.

🚗 Ride-share: ✅ Uber, BoltUber has long operated in Świnoujście; Bolt launched May 2025.🚍 Hop-on hop-off: ❌ No HOHO bus

🚕 Taxi

13–16 PLN (€3–4)

Taxis are plentiful and cheap for the short ride from the cruise terminal to the city center — typically under 2 km. Local firms include Radio Taxi; metered fares apply.

📱 Uber / Bolt

Similar to taxi (app-based)

Both Uber and Bolt are confirmed active in Świnoujście as of 2025. Bolt launched here in May 2025, offering transparent upfront pricing via app.

🚌 Public Bus

~4–6 PLN per ride

Bus line 1 connects the port area to Świnoujście Centrum in about 4 minutes. Line 93 also runs to the central bus station on the Wolin side.

🛺 Melex (Electric Cart Tour)

Varies by operator

Small electric carts offer sightseeing loops covering the spa district, beach promenade, and historic forts — a popular option for cruise passengers.

🚲 Cycling

Rental rates vary

Świnoujście has 100+ km of marked bike lanes, making cycling an excellent way to explore the beach promenade, spa park, and German border at Ahlbeck.
